Southern Social Restaurant Review

Rich and I went to the restaurant Southern Social, It’s a local place that is about to have a new location in my city. So Rich and I thought we should check it out before it opens in my city. We went at about 2:30 on a Sunday so It would be after brunch and hopefully not busy.
We ordered our drinks and our server was fantastic and took good care of us. I had the Redeye which is a meatloaf dish and it was fantastic. Here is what the redeye is Wagyu meatloaf, cheddar grits, veal gravy, over easy egg, scallions. and runs $18.95. I love meatloaf and this was great it was a 9 out of 10 but very close to 10.

Rich ordered the Jambayla which was Creole sauce, andouille sausage, chicken, pork, shrimp, crawfish tails, and rice. and cost $22.95. He said it had more meat than rice and he said it was a 10 out of 10.

We really like this restaurant and can’t wait for it to come to my town so I can take my parents especially since she is from Texas and loves this food. So I can say they have great food, service, and ambiance. If you are from Minnesota Rich and I say it’s a go-to spot. There was only one bad thing about the entire meal. It’s me forgetting my leftovers at the table and I can’t have any more right now.

Ted Series on Peacock

Ted is a new tv series on Peacock that is a prequel to Ted the movie.

If you liked Ted 1 & 2 you will probably like the TV show. Also if you like any Seth MacFarlane movies and TV shows you will like Ted the TV show. It stars Max Burkholder as John Bennett and Seth MacFarlane as the voice of Ted.

Two stars from the Orville are in this show. The first is Scott Grimes who played Gordon Malloy as the father Matty Bennett and Penny Johnson Jerald as Dr. Claire Finn who is the school principal. Alana Ubech is the mother Susan Bennett. Lastly Georgia Whigham is Johns cousin Blaire Bennett. Since it’s a prequel the year this show takes place is 1993. I really like Max as John he’s very down to earth and funny but can also be sweet when he needs to be. Ted as always is a bad influence and other family members try and keep John on the right path. The show is very funny in parts. Also if you like family guy you will like this. It’s very similar even the intro and outro music. Everyone on the show is good and the characters are good.

The first episode is all about Ted going to school with John and in typical Ted fashion he tries to get kicked out. It’s funny but the principal see right through him and she won’t kick him out. This one is funny but if it’s always the same it might get old. But then again the Family Guy is still very popular. I really like Ted the series and can’t wait to see where it goes from here.
